1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ette vs. 2008 Saab 05-Sep

To start off, 2008 Saab 05-Sep is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ette would be higher. At 3,133 cc (6 cylinders), 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Saab 05-Sep (260 HP @ 5300 RPM) has 142 more horse power than 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ette. (118 HP @ 4200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Saab 05-Sep should accelerate faster than 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ette weights approximately 60 kg more than 2008 Saab 05-Sep.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Saab 05-Sep (350 Nm @ 1900 RPM) has 113 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ette. (237 Nm @ 2200 RPM). This means 2008 Saab 05-Sep will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Oldsmobile Silhouette.
